Counterconditioning
A behavior therapy procedure that uses classical conditioning to evoke new responses to stimuli that are triggering unwanted behaviors; includes exposure therapies and aversive conditioning.

Insight Therapies
A variety of therapies that aim to improve psychological functioning by increasing the client’s awareness of underlying motives and defenses.
